Newcomers don't rebuild the majority of their team's spots with drafts; they do it with free agents. The drafts are too slow and unreliable. Newbies can make several incremental improvements with free agents in a few weeks.

A newcomer has to wait several seasons for a draftee to reach the majors - at least if he doesn't want to burn them by bringing them up straight out of college (and the college pool is drained damn fast, as well). I don't think it makes any difference either way if he has to wait half a season to draft a pitcher. It probably takes more than half a season to figure out who a good prospect is, anyway. If you want to do anything to keep the draft interesting after mid-season, bring the larger pools back that we had until 2019.

From my experience my minor league system would turn into all pitchers if I had that option. I can easily pick up top players for my team in terms of position players in free agents. As for pitchers this is next to impossible to do and instead I have to rely on my minors to develop a good pitching staff. Even with the the position players I developed that are now 23-24 (my first HS draft picks) seem a bit of a waste of space because I know I can sign free agents that are better than them with almost as good potential just a little older. On the other hand the only hope I have of fixing my pitching staff is through my minors because unless your really lucky you aren't going to get any good pitchers or even pitching prospects from waivers or free agency
